`Annecy': a Lalique clear glass vase, designed 1935

Description

  • glass
  • 14.5cm., 5 3/4 in. high
of tapering cylindrical form, moulded with wavy dentil ribbing, stencilled R.LALIQUE FRANCE mark

Literature

West Horsley Place, Surrey, Inventory, 1938, Vol. 1, p.82, in the Ante Room; An 8½” lalique cut glass Vase. 

Condition

There is some typical wear and scratches to the underside of the foot.

Catalogue Note

For the model, first created in February 1935, see F.Marcillac, René Lalique, 1860-1945, 1989, p.461, no. 10-884.
